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C problems require emergency service. Recognizing these concerns can help you understand when to call for professional aid: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working entirely, especially throughout severe weather condition, it's more than simply an hassle-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C professionals can detect and fix the issue promptly,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Unusual sounds like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system often signal a severe mechanical problem that might cause bigger problems if not attended to quickly. Likewise, uncommon smells may suggest electrical problems and even gas leakages. Our expert HVAC contractors can identify these problems and make necessary repair work before they end up being harmful.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can harm your home and cause mold development. Our specialists locate the source of leakages and repair them effectively to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ks decrease your air conditioner's cooling capability and can harm the environment. They need professional attention as refrigerant dealing with require spec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ical parts in your HVAC system pose fire hazards and ought to be resolved right away by qualified experts. Our HVAC specialists have the training to safely fix electrical problems.

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ted airflow makes your system work harder and reduces comfort. Our HVAC specialists determine air flow problems, whether caused by duct concerns, unclean filters, or fan issues.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ation issues, or an incorrectly sized system. Our expert HVAC contractors can identify these problems and recommend services.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system turns on and off frequently, it loses energy and wears out components much faster. Our HVAC specialists can figure out whether the problem stems from a stopped up fil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ected boosts in energy expenses often show HVAC inadequacy. Our specialists carry out energy performance evaluations to determine the cause and suggest impro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ems must assist control ind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er or too dry in winter, our HVAC specialists can suggest solutions to improve conv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what seems like a system failure is actually a thermostat problem. Our HVAC contractors can fix or change thermostats and assist you update to programmable or wise models for better comfort control and energy savings.
